The AirBar, A Sensor That Adds Touch Capability to a PC Screen

The AirBar is a sensor that adds touch capability to a PC screen. The device simply plugs into a USB port and lays at the base of a computer screen running Windows 8 or Windows 10 and allows users to make Windows touch screen gestures like pinching, zooming, and scrolling.

The plug-and-play design does not require any additional software installation or setup, and because the sensor works with a light field, the touch feature works with any material, not just fingers or a stylus.
